n73 has only 17-18 mb free ram when booted
so dont expect much running inbuilt browser would use up about 5-7 mb when loaded and when loading website pages it uses more ram even if u run any app when u have already loaded ur browser then u will end up with browser closed..!!!
but runnin small apps would b fine
and in slick there is an optin to mark it as system application. you shoul do that so that atleast slick wont b closed in low memory conditions
